A If you are connecting to a video input jack
Connect the yellow plug of the audio/video cord (supplied) to the yellow (video) jacks. You will
enjoy standard quality images.

Use the red and white plugs to connect to the audio input jacks (page 22). (Do this if you are
connecting to a TV only.)
B If you are connecting to an S VIDEO input jack
Connect an S VIDEO cord (not supplied). You will enjoy high quality images.
C If you are connecting to a SCART (EURO AV) input jack
Connect the supplied EURO AV adaptor to the SCART (EURO AV) input jack of the TV and
connect the player and the EURO AV adaptor using the audio/video cord (supplied). Connect
the yellow plugs of the audio/video cord to the yellow (video) jacks. Use the red and white plugs
to connect the audio input jack (page 22).

Connect the component via the COMPONENT VIDEO OUT jacks using a component video
cord (not supplied) or three video cords (not supplied) of the same kind and length. You will
enjoy accurate colour reproduction and high quality images.
If your TV or video component has a CONTROL S connector
You can control the player by pointing the remote at the remote sensor on the TV or video component. This
feature is convenient when you placed the player and the TV or video component away from each other.
Connect the TV or video component via the CONTROL S IN connectors using the control S cord (not
supplied). Refer to the instructions supplied with the component to be connected.
